(Reuters) -Triple Formula One world champion Max Verstappen set an ominous pace as Red Bull, dominant last year, picked up where they left off on the first day of pre-season testing in Bahrain on Wednesday.
Even if the timesheets could be easily dismissed, with teams running different programmes, there was no denying that the new Red Bull already looked a step up from last year's RB19.
